Output ea59efa232216adcd7b32e765c18fa8bbd0f8ba5bf4f737de7361240ee075dfd:0

value
25850
script pubkey
OP_0 OP_PUSHBYTES_20 287db25d9059879edf397e04ddfb95b6b701fbb4
address
bc1q9p7myhvstxreahee0czdm7u4k6msr7a575pwx2
transaction
ea59efa232216adcd7b32e765c18fa8bbd0f8ba5bf4f737de7361240ee075dfd
confirmations
24525
spent
true